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0467371 7926153 629375445 7968891 93123
3716530917 8410956058
3716530917 8410956058
792 2518 226866 889
All about undefined
Interested in learning more?
3716530917 8410956058
792 2518 226866 889
See more
470683573 5580 327269
9850 78 61148062
See more
90318716 8758023623 49150160
585169718 57357 331136532 641
See more